The release of FluxMotor, a dedicated platform focusing on the pre-design of electric rotating machines has been announced by Altair. FluxMotor is part of Altair’s HyperWorks CAE Suite, which includes Flux the leading software for low frequency electromagnetic and thermal simulations.
The software tool allowsusers to design and create machines from standard or customised parts, as well as to intuitively add windings and materials to run a selection of tests and compare machine capacity.
“FluxMotor is an easy-to-use and efficient dedicated predesign tool, targeting designers from all sectors related to the electric motors field” said Grégory Michaud, Electromagnetic Engineer at SoftBank Robotics, who was involved in the testing phase of the new software together with the development team.
Appealing to a broad range of users such as designers and manufacturers of electrical rotating motors, the software allows motor specialists to define machines and assess their technical-economic potential within minutes. FluxMotor's efficient working environment ensures a better visualisation of machine performances, enabling fast and accurate computations which can easily be connected to Flux finite element software and other tools within the HyperWorks suite for more advance studies, including multiphysics optimisation capabilities.
